JSON ke TypeScript
Hasilkan interface atau type alias TypeScript dari contoh JSON.
Tentang JSON ke TypeScript
Interface dan type alias TypeScript mendefinisikan bentuk data, memungkinkan pengecekan tipe dan pelengkapan otomatis IDE. Menulis tipe secara manual untuk struktur JSON yang kompleks memakan waktu dan rentan kesalahan. Alat ini secara otomatis menyimpulkan definisi TypeScript dari contoh JSON, menangani objek bersarang, array, field opsional, dan tipe union.
Cara Menggunakan
Tempel contoh JSON di area masukan dan atur nama tipe root (default: "Root"). Pilih antara gaya keluaran "interface" dan "type". Klik "Hasilkan" untuk membuat definisi TypeScript. Objek bersarang secara otomatis menghasilkan sub-tipe. Salin keluarannya dengan satu klik.
Kasus Penggunaan Umum
- Menghasilkan tipe dari contoh respons API untuk pengembangan frontend
- Membuat interface dari hasil query database
- Membangun definisi tipe untuk berkas konfigurasi
- Mengonversi skema JSON ke TypeScript untuk validasi formulir
- Membuat kerangka tipe dengan cepat selama prototyping